GMC Yukon

1996 GMC Yukon 5.7 2WD, 145,000 miles.

My truck was having a " hard to start when cold" problem, had the fuel pump and fuel filter replaced and that solved the problem but now there's black smoke coming out from the exaust and the engine misses and sputters alot, codes read MAS sensor, replaced it but no difference. Please help.
April 18, 2007.

